By Deborah Rosenthal
        If Daniel M. Petrocelli had been a better musician, O.J. Simpson never might have been found liable for the deaths of Nicole Brown Simpson and Ron Goldman. Petrocelli majored in music at UCLA, where he graduated cum laude in 1976, but fortunately for his future clients, Petrocelli realized early in life that music was not his forté.
